In this fun and lighthearted story, Pai Pai stuffs his belly silly with his favorite people in the world: his family! This bilingual board book highlights meaningful words such as family member names while introducing your little ones to some tasty Asian foods. Crafted with simple and easy-to-follow sentences and repetition, this book is sure to capture your little one's mind and appetite!

A reading guide is also included, providing simple language-building strategies to use during book reading, play time, and your child's very own snack and meal times.

Written in Traditional Chinese, Pinyin, and English.

About Beach Day Press

Amy Liang (the founder of Beach Day Press) is a speech-language pathologist and proud mother of 2. She works in early language development and wanted to combine her professional knowledge with personal experience to create a series of engaging and educational bilingual books for young bilingual readers. In her work, she always noticed there was a significant gap in available resources that were useful for language therapy and supporting early language skills. So, rather than continue to improvise, she chose to make her own! That’s how Beach Day Press was born.

Now, her books focus on helping children expand their language abilities as they grow:

  • Daily routines — The Beach Day Press books are centred around daily routines to help young children learn language through familiar contexts and activities that they engage in every day. They make perfect opportunities to learn and build on language skills!

  • Meaningful vocabulary — Every book emphasises words that are useful and functional, thus resonating with young children. From everyday objects, basic prepositions to family members, body parts and animals: the aim is to help children learn words that help them communicate in everyday life.

  • Repetition, repetition, repetition — These books are designed to be engaging and easy to follow for young children. Repetition allows little readers to refine their understanding and learn how it’s used in different sentences. The predictable text gives children confidence to fill in the blanks and participate in reading along!

  • The power of verbs — Each book highlights an everyday action to help children learn the action word (verb). Learning verbs help children combine words into phrases and sentences. WIth one verb, children can make many different combinations! (e.g. eat apple, eat more, I eat, they eat)

  • Reading guides — Each book comes with a reading guide to provide parents and caregivers with language-building strategies to use during reading time. They can also be easily integrated into their routines and playtime to create a bilingual environment that helps children learn naturally.

  • Bright, simple illustrations — The illustrations ensure that the books are visually engaging and easy to interpret without being overly distracting.
